Realm of validity of the Crooks relation

Abstract: We consider the distribution P (φ) of the Hatano-Sasa entropy, φ, in reversible and irreversible processes, finding that the Crook's relation for the ratio of the pdf's of the forward and backward processes, P F (φ)/P R (−φ) = e φ , is satisfied not only for reversible, but also for irreversible processes, in general, in the adiabatic limit of "slow processes." Focusing on systems with a finite set of discrete states (and no absorbing states), we observe that two-state systems always fulfill detailed balance, … Show more
